Jordi Valadon
8 Midfielder
Quickly establishing himself as one of the most promising midfielders in Australian football, youngster Jordi Valadon has become a crucial member of Melbourne Victory’s A-League Men’s squad.
Growing up supporting Victory, Valadon completed the switch across from rivals City, making his A-League starting debut against Brisbane Roar at AAMI Park just months after joining the club.
Returning from a hamstring injury, Valadon began to receive regular game time at the latter stage of the 2023/24 season, particularly putting in some impressive performances during the Finals Series.
As a result, Valadon maintained his starting role into the 2024/25 campaign, standing out in the middle of the park for his tenacity and strong technical ability.
Finishing out the season making 35 appearances and providing eight assists in all competitions, Valadon took home the 2025 Victory Medal at the age of 22, becoming the youngest Men’s player to receive the honour.
